On 2 Sep 2015, at 12:50, Avi Freedman wrote:
> + optimal tweaks include local flow proxy that can also rate
> limit / re-sample, and send topk talkers over 'true' OOB.
Yes, a lot of distributed flow collection/analysis architectures are
deployed this way, doing more than top-talkers, even. The key is that
traffic between the elements of those types of deployments *must* not be
disrupted; true OOB is preferred, but VLAN/VRF is still the norm, there.
